Thales Group Bushmaster and Otokar Arma are both ifv / apc, compared here on public specifications. The Thales Group Bushmaster leads on range (800 vs 700 km).

Performance
Max speed (km/h) 100 km/h 105 km/h
Range (km) 800 km 700 km
Power-to-weight (hp/t) N/A 20 hp/t
Firepower
Caliber (mm) 7.6 mm N/A
Physical
Length (m) 7.18 m 7.3 m
Combat weight (kg) 14,500 kg 22,000 kg
Crew 2 2
Troop capacity 8 10
Propulsion
Engine power (hp) 300 hp N/A
Program
Units built 1,000 N/A
Operator countries 8 4

Is the Thales Group Bushmaster better than the Otokar Arma? +

On the public specs we track, Thales Group Bushmaster and Otokar Arma are closely matched, Thales Group Bushmaster leads on range, operator countries, while Otokar Arma leads on max speed, troop capacity. See the full spec sheet for the metric-by-metric breakdown.
